The danger of hypocrisy

What is hypocrisy and how dangerous is it for the Muslims? Praise be to Allaah. Hypocrisy is a serious sickness and a great crime. It means making an outward display of Islam whilst inwardly concealing kufr. Hypocrisy is more dangerous than kufr (disbelief) and the punishment for it is more severe, because it is kufr …

Different kinds of Shirk

There are three different kinds of Shirk: 1) The Greater Shirk 2) The Lesser Shirk 3) The Hidden Shirk THE GREATER SHIRK: For the one who dies upon it, the Greater Shirk results in the nullification of deeds and eternity in the Hellfire.
